Hunting For Sources

without comments

Every news blogger wants to post his niche newsbits or just something interesting earlier than the competitors. The best way is to find valuable sources (insiders, enthusiasts, evangelists, etc.) and follow their RSS feeds. Today I”ve discovered a brand new tool for the hardcore news hunters - Tweet Scan. Type in your keyword and press ’search’.
